,

Mempelajari Express JS | 3. Penggunaan Dasar Routing dengan Metode HTTP GET

Posted by






Belajar Express JS | 3. Dasar routing menggunakan GET HTTP Method

Belajar Express JS | 3. Dasar routing menggunakan GET HTTP Method

Express JS adalah framework web yang sangat populer untuk membuat aplikasi web menggunakan bahasa pemrograman JavaScript. Dalam tutorial ini, kita akan belajar tentang dasar-dasar routing menggunakan GET HTTP method di Express JS.

Step 1: Install Express JS

Pertama-tama, pastikan Anda sudah menginstal Node.js di komputer Anda. Kemudian, buat sebuah direktori baru untuk proyek Anda dan jalankan perintah berikut untuk menginstal Express JS:

npm install express

Step 2: Buat File Server

Buatlah file JavaScript baru (misalnya server.js) dan tambahkan kode berikut untuk membuat server Express:


const express = require('express');
const app = express();

app.get('/', (req, res) => {
res.send('Halo, dunia!');
});

app.listen(3000, () => {
console.log('Server berjalan di port 3000');
});

Step 3: Menggunakan GET Method

Sekarang, kita akan membuat sebuah routing menggunakan GET HTTP method. Tambahkan kode berikut di dalam file server.js:


app.get('/halo', (req, res) => {
res.send('Halo, pengguna!');
});

Dengan kode di atas, kita membuat routing untuk URL “/halo” dengan menggunakan metode GET. Ketika pengguna mengakses URL tersebut, server akan mengirimkan pesan “Halo, pengguna!” sebagai respons.

Step 4: Menjalankan Server

Terakhir, jalankan server Anda dengan mengetikkan perintah berikut di terminal:

node server.js

Server Anda sekarang berjalan di port 3000. Buka browser dan akses URL “http://localhost:3000/halo” untuk melihat hasilnya.

Kesimpulan

Sekarang Anda telah belajar dasar-dasar routing menggunakan GET HTTP method di Express JS. Anda dapat menggabungkan lebih banyak routing dengan metode HTTP lainnya untuk membuat aplikasi web yang lebih kompleks.

Teruslah belajar dan eksperimen dengan Express JS untuk mengeksplorasi berbagai fitur yang ditawarkannya!


0 0 votes
Article Rating
1 Comment
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
usaid aka
7 months ago

req res itu bukannya sebagai parameter bang? di video disebut variabel?